You can read part one lower down this page.The players must be ready for Ange-ball immediately, there will be no half measures, no steady introduction. He knows the way he wants to play - whether it was criticised at Tottenham or not - and they will be asked to do that from day one. The counter-attacking game which served Forest so well under Nuno will remain to a point - Postecoglou will utilise it - pressing and possession will be quickly brought in. The clarity will be there and he will demand commitment but he is good at selling his vision, looking for players to follow him. He will invariably pick his team the day before a game but sometimes may not name it until matchday, although with 10 v 10 games in training - the likely starting line up against others - players will know the expected team.Post match he keeps many thoughts to himself, opting to reflect on the result and performance rather than any instant reactions, a ploy many managers use. Come Monday morning there will be a meeting to debrief the game with a video of around 10 minutes. It will review the structure, how players have reacted to losing the ball, penetration, attacking the box. This will be reinforced through the season. The 60-year-old guided Spurs to their first trophy in 17-years after beating Manchester United in Bilbao in May. But 16 days later he was axed having finished 17th in the Premier League - 27 points adrift of Forest last season. He replaced the sacked Nuno Espirito Santo at the City Ground on Tuesday to return to management. "It wasn't great. I knew it was coming so it wasn't a surprise," he said at his Forest unveiling."It was a great three days [winning the Europa League] and I didn't want it to damage that. Whether I feel it was unjust other people make those decisions, they make those determinations. That's up to them, they have their own reasoning for it. "To be fair, I've done it a couple of times myself. I left Celtic and I'm sure they were disappointed. You understand that's part of the business we're in. But that's OK. It's allowed me now to move into this and maybe things happen for a reason."What I do know is I had two years where it was very, very challenging but we were with some fantastic people. There isn't a Spurs supporter that I don't come across now that doesn't want to hug me and take me home for dinner. "So I must have done something right. I think ultimately that's what we do it for. I'm very proud of what we achieved there. It will always take a special place in my heart. What could possibly fly out of the blue?Well, the departure of the single most significant individual at Tottenham in the 21st Century would probably fit the bill.Daniel Levy's ideas and influence dominated every single major moment in Spurs history for the past 25 years. His achievements, his mistakes and his contradictions run through Tottenham Hotspur as though through a stick of rock.The creation of one of the finest football stadiums in the world, the urgent pursuit of regular Champions League football, although perhaps not the resources to always make it happen, and until recently, a consistent failure to bring home the trophies the supporters craved. All these things are Daniel Levy and they are Tottenham Hotspur. Until now.The new decision-makers will have to take the Levy blueprint and decide how to vary it.While his approach stayed remarkably consistent over the course of the past 25 years, football at the top has changed fundamentally. If the new decision-makers want to turn Spurs into another Premier League behemoth that uses financial muscle to challenge for the big trophies, they will find there is an awful lot of elbowing required, even if you have got the money.More of the same, or gambling, or trying something entirely new? All have risks attached. Maybe that is why the former Tottenham chairman should get credit – his approach proved remarkably durable during a period of seismic change.As the two parties finally go their separate ways, it is worth marvelling at the deep ironies of the past few months. Instead of challenging for the top four, which was always the main priority, Spurs chased a trophy, allowed their league form to disintegrate and then gave the fans their greatest moment in decades, including Champions League qualification. Video, 00:00:32, published at 13:22 BST 10 September'It's good to make history' - Spence on England debutAttributionFootball0:32'Good to make history' - Spence on being England's first Muslim playerpublished at 09:25 BST 10 September09:25 BST 10 SeptemberImage source, PA MediaDjed Spence hopes becoming the first Muslim player to represent England will help create a path for more to follow. The full-back replaced Reece James as England beat Serbia 5-0 in a World Cup qualifying match on Tuesday and the Spurs defender wants more Muslims to tread the same path."It is a blessing," Spence said. "It is good to make history and hopefully it spurs young kids on around the world so they can make it and do what I am doing. "I was surprised - I didn't know I was the first. I hope it paves the way for many more. Whatever religion you believe in, just believe in God. God is the greatest. He never lets you down. "You see days like today - it is all because of God."The 25-year-old received his legacy cap from England captain Harry Kane following the match and Spence said he was "a bit emotional" after the journey he had been on to get there. "He [Kane] gave it to me when I was in the dressing room. He said I was at Tottenham with him a few years ago and he has seen my growth and he knows how hard it is to get to this level and was just happy for me," Spence added."It was amazing - it has been a long time coming. I have dreamed about it all my life. It is an honour. I'm a little bit emotional from the journey I have been on. "I'm officially an England player now so I am over the moon." They finished second in the Premier League in 2016-17, reached 15 semi-finals and six finals, including the Champions League showpiece in 2019 where they lost to Liverpool.Levy is a polarising character and was often accused of extreme frugality during his time as executive chairman. The club made a profit in the transfer market between 2010 and 2020, which coincided with their most successful period of Premier League finishes.In the five years since, he agreed to a net spend of more than £450m in an attempt to keep up with rival teams.
